Austria says that it is investigating two men who are suspected of being involved in last month's Paris attack. The men were found in a Salzburg migrant shelter over the weekend and arrested.
According to State Prosecutor Robert Holzleitner, the pair are suspected of "participation in a terrorist organization," and likely connected to the Paris attack. Holzleitner did not specify where they originally came from, only noting that is in the Middle East. He claimed that saying more could endanger the investigation.
However, the Kronen Zeitung newspaper says that the two came from Pakistan and Algeria, and are French citizens. It added that they used fake Syrian passports to enter Austria in October.
